Whether you’re planning a complete kitchen overhaul or simply looking to incorporate retro-inspired elements, these 41 mid-century modern kitchen decor ideas will help you achieve that coveted vintage-meets-contemporary look.

Born from the architectural revolution of the 1940s through the 1960s, this distinctive style brings together clean lines, organic curves, and a perfect balance of form and function.

Mid-century modern design continues to captivate homeowners with its timeless blend of functionality and aesthetic appeal.
